I recently had a disappointing experience with Rockland Apartments’ billing when I was charged twice for the same month. While I understand that mistakes happen, I find it unacceptable to be told that I am responsible for an error that was clearly on their end. On top of this, I

now have to wait an entire month to receive a refund via check, which only adds to the inconvenience. This incident reflects broader issues with the complex. While the apartments are affordable, the quality leaves much to be desired. My heater frequently breaks, and the plumbing is outdated—leading to a hole in the ceiling of the clubhouse. Additionally, the dryers in the laundry room are inconsistent, sometimes working well and other times leaving clothes damp. I don’t expect luxury, but I do expect basic competence and accountability from management, and unfortunately, my experience suggests that both are in short supply here. For the same price, there are other apartments with better quality in both service and maintenance. That said, there are a few positives. The complex has a small but effective gym that’s convenient, and the outdoor fire pit is a nice touch for gathering with friends or relaxing. Also, I found the accounting office to be understanding once I got in touch with them—they acknowledged their mistake and took responsibility, which was a relief compared to the initial response I received.

If you are sifting through Google reviews to find desirable student housing and are considering the refurbished Rockland Apartments, here are the facts about the complex as I have experienced them during my stay here in Winter Semester 2023. Amenities: Treadmill was broken for the entirety of the semester. Dumbbell weight

set is solid, if somewhat limited. The pool table was broken for the majority of the semester. I have not tried the pool or hot tub. You can take a look for yourself and consider whether you would use them. Final Clean Check: (Check the images for the Job #2 list.) If you don't fulfill a single task you will be fined approximately $650. This is about half the contract's original price. ($1350ish) There is a pre check where cleaning crews come through and point out what you need to clean. However, there is no guarantee that the pre-checkers version of "clean" is the same as the managers. You must return your key and sign an agreement upon check out that you agree to the terms of the clean check operations or management will confiscate your deposit and fine you. You must check out in person or again you forfeit your deposit and will be fined. Rooms: Carpets look and felt extremely aged and frayed. I recommend getting a carpet for your room and your living room if you like to spread out on the floor. One desk to two people. Ample space for storage. Ethernet port. Light bulbs were extremely white, so I replaced them for a softer yellow. Laundry: Check the pictures. In summation, 1 load a week will cost $30. Parking: Extra fee for a parking pass. The parking is not covered. During winter semester, residents will randomly receive notices that cleaners will come and remove ice. Watch your door for these or you will be toed. Kitchen: Burners would randomly turn off during cooking. Microwave worked perfectly. Dishwasher cleaned things for the most part, if you are okay with some hard water build up and calcification. I cook tea and I would have to clean my kettle with white vinegar each time I used it because there was some much calcification. I eventually stopped using it for the hassle. Oven, sink, fridge, freezer, pantries, and garbage disposal all work perfectly. Living Room: The living room is about 18x23x9 (I'm only eyeballing it however) which is plenty. The tv by comparison is 55 inches. The sectional is comfortable and easy to clean. Eye strain is required at times if you play video games on the tv (small HUD information is quite small from 13ish feet away on a 55 inch screen). Vanity: I wish I had changed the bulbs to a more amber color but I couldn't find the lightbulbs at Walmart. The calking in the marble seams of the counter and the floorboards is spotty and colored, standing out like a sore thumb under the harsh white LEDs. Personal Opinion: I have relayed the facts of my residence in Rockland apartments and here is my personal conclusion concerning its quality; it is just my opinion, do with it as you will. Rockland Apartments, compared to other men's apartment contracts, is not a competitive apartment complex because the amenities, clean check procedures, interior, kitchen, and laundry facilities are inferior. For example, how does Rockland compare to The Roost? If you buy a singles contract at The Roost you will pay about the exact same price as Rockland ($1450) and if you get your security deposit back ($400), you will pay less than Rockland's $1350ish. This includes an indoor washer/dryer, and sleek apartment finishes/designs (check their website for comparisons, Marriot vs. Motel 6 anyone?). It is nearly the exact same distance from BYUI's campus. It has a reputation as being highly reputable with a solid management. It's amenities are consistently well-maintained. The Lodge, Northpoint, and the Cedar's are also, in my opinion, higher quality residential experiences for a slightly higher price. Rockland is not a quality residential experience compared to housing complexes in its price range. I cannot recommend anything but buying a contract elsewhere.

The apartment is livable in some ways—it’s in a convenient location, and the layout is decent enough. However, there are some major issues that make staying here frustrating. The dryers don’t work properly, and the plumbing is unreliable, breaking down more often than it should. Despite these problems being brought

to management’s attention, they remain unresolved. If these issues aren’t fixed soon, I don’t think it’s fair to be charged the full rent. I might even consider asking for a refund if things don’t improve.

This place was old and the amenities are horribly kept. Where to even start… The washing machines were always covered with old and crusty washing scum. Nothing was ever cleaned all semester. I swept and cleaned all the machines and will post the proof. The scrub sink was also broken and

had water sitting in it all semester. The tub water was putrid the majority of the semester. Was visibly green often and smelled awful. My apartment was leaking water from upstairs into our apartment through a windowsill. It was rancid water. Smelled like piss. Was never addressed. Even when we reported it 3 times. There was also no way to reach the manager. Still haven’t received my security deposit even though I passed my clean checks. So, not a great place.
